MAT 202: Finite
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
MathematicsA general course introducing such topics as sets and functions, matrix theory, linear systems, linear programming and probability theory. Applications are taken from business, biology, and the behavioral sciences. Prerequisite: MAT 112 or equivalent. Offered every fall and summer. (3 s.h.)

MAT 204: Calculus I
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
A general introduction to analytical geometry, differentiation and integration with applications. Prerequisite: MAT 112 or its equivalent, such as intermediate high school algebra and trigonometry. Offered every fall. (4 s.h.)

MAT 205: Calculus II
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
A continuation of MAT 204, including integration techniques and applications, the calculus of polar and parametric equations, partial derivatives, infinite series and an introduction to vectors. Prerequisite: MAT 204. Offered every spring. (4 s.h.)

MAT 221: Mathematics for Elementary Teachers
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
This course is designed to provide elementary teachers with an introduction to the fundamental concepts of numeration systems, set theory, arithmetic operations, probability, measurement, algebraic problem solving, and geometry from an axiomatic point of view. The course is a mathematics content course with the material presented to the perspective of a future teacher. Required course for all Elementary Education majors. Prerequisite: MAT 112 or higher. Offered every spring. (4 s.h.)

MAT 233: Introduction to Statistics
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
An introduction to the fundamentals of statistics with applications. Topics include frequency distributions, sampling distributions, testing hypotheses, analysis of variance, regression and correlations and nonparametric methods. Prerequisites: MAT 111 or equivalent. Offered every spring and summer, and Interims of even-numbered years. (3 s.h.)

MAT 300: Numerical Methods
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
Mathematical techniques most needed by those engaged in computational mathematics. Topics include numerical integration, optimization, polynomial approximation, matrix inversion, and approximate solutions to boundary value problems. Prerequisites: COM 201 and MAT 204, with COM 202 and COM/MAT 306 recommended. Offered Interims of even-numbered years. (3 s.h.)

MAT 302: Probability & Statistics
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
An introduction at the calculus level to discrete and continuous probability distributions, including a study of the normal distribution, the Central Limit Theorem, and its application to the statistics of sampling. Prerequisite: MAT 205. Offered fall semesters of even-numbered years. (3 s.h.)

MAT 303: Foundations of Geometry
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
The foundations and fundamental concepts of mathematics including Euclidean and non-Euclidean geometry. Prerequisite: MAT 112 or equivalent. Offered spring semesters of even-numbered years. (3 s.h.)

MAT 304: Linear Algebra
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
An introduction to vector spaces, linear transformations and matrices with applications to each. Prerequisite: MAT 204 or instructor approval. Offered spring semesters of odd-numbered years. (3 s.h.)

MAT 305: Abstract Algebra
3.00 Credits
University of Sioux Falls
An introduction to abstract mathematical systems, including groups, rings and fields. Prerequisite: MAT 204 or instructor approval. Offered fall semesters of odd-numbered years. (3 s.h.)
